Byram High School Salary

How much does the Byram High School Pay for employees?

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Byram High School in the United States is $79,458.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$38. Salaries at Byram High School typically range from $69,469 to $90,942 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company. Byram High School’s salaries are influenced by a wide range of factors including job role, department, years of experience, and location.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Jackson?

Understanding the cost of living near Jackson is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Byram High School.
Jackson's Cost of Living Index is approximately 78.4 (21.6% less expensive than US average; 8.8% less than MS average). State capital, very affordable housing. JATRAN. When planning your budget based on a salary from Byram High School,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$800 - $1,200+ A significant portion of Byram High School sal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(JATRAN mon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$360 - $540 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$300 - $580+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$640+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,000 - $3,210+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
